Tina Funnell
Councillor - Heworth Ward
Personal Details
- I was born in Yorkshire with a Dutch mother and a very Yorkshire Dad. I have a grownup daughter and son, who both live in Hertfordshire, but love to visit York with their partners & friends
- I am a Hull University graduate in social administration and have been a youth worker involved with many local support groups. I work with several patient charities and recently have worked with the NHS at national and regional level. I enjoy gardening, DIY, music, concerts, reading and spending time with friends and family.
The campaign
Residents have their say in “Shaping local Services”
We know that the following issues are most important to residents in Heworth through our regular surgeries, meetings and newsletters. We will work to ensure that these services meet the needs of all residents in the Ward.
Caring for Older People
- Fighting for replacement bungalows for the residents of Discus bungalows.
- Working to provide services to prevent isolation and keeping older people independent in their own homes.
- Working with the Police to help stop older people’s fear of crime.
Environment
- Working to keep the Ward clean, free of litter and graffiti.
- Working to enhance the River Foss, South Beck and Tang Hall Beck as green corridors through the Ward.
- Ensuring that all parks, gardens and open spaces are well maintained and well used by residents
Community Safety
- Working to ensure the Police patrol in all areas of the Ward and keep our roads safe.
- Providing extra street-lighting through the Ward Committee.
- Working with residents to extend the number of Neighbourhood Watch schemes in Heworth
Traffic and urban development
- Continuing to fight against overdevelopment in the Heworth Green and Layerthorpe area.
- Working for a transport masterplan to stop congestions in the area and to get better bus services.
- Continuing to fight for better planning of services and use of land owned by the Council, starting with the Tang Hall and Muncaster areas of the Ward.
